VS Code离线插件存放于扩展目录下,具体位置因操作系统而异。Windows系统下,此目录通常位于C:\Users\{用户名}\.vscode\extensions
。Linux和macOS系统下,路径分别为~/.vscode/extensions
和~/.vscode/extensions
。这一位置是VS Code查找和加载已安装插件的默认路径。对于离线安装插件,用户需将下载好的插件包(通常为.vsix
文件)手动放入此目录,或通过VS Code的命令行接口进行安装。
一、VS CODE插件架构
Visual Studio Code(VS Code)通过其强大的扩展生态系统提供高度可定制的开发环境体验。这些插件扩展了编辑器的功能,涵盖从语言支持、代码格式化到版本控制等多个方面。VS Code的插件架构设计灵活,允许开发者和用户根据需求增加或修改功能。
二、离线安装插件的步骤
离线安装VS Code插件主要涉及获取插件文件、放置插件文件到指定目录,和通过VS Code命令行接口安装插件这几个步骤。首要步骤是从可靠源下载所需的插件包,它们通常以.vsix
文件形式存在。其次,用户需要将下载好的插件文件放置到VS Code的扩展目录下。在某些情况下,也可以通过VS Code的命令行接口使用特定命令安装插件,这为插件安装提供了更大的灵活性。
三、VS CODE的扩展目录
VS Code的扩展目录是其查找并加载已安装扩展的主要位置。正如之前提及,这个目录的位置根据所使用的操作系统有所不同。理解这一目录的位置对于手动管理VS Code插件尤其重要,特别是在需要进行离线安装或调试插件时。
四、通过命令行安装插件
除了手动放置插件文件到扩展目录,VS Code还提供通过命令行接口安装插件的方式。这可以通过打开VS Code的命令面板,输入相关命令实现。使用命令行安装插件时,还可以指定插件存放的目标位置,从而提高安装过程的灵活性。
五、管理和更新离线插件
离线安装的插件也需要适时更新,以确保插件的功能与安全性。这通常需要手动下载最新版本的插件,并重复离线安装的步骤。此外,VS Code允许用户通过内置的界面管理已安装的插件,包括启用、禁用和移除插件。对于离线环境下使用VS Code的用户,定期检查插件的更新是确保开发环境稳定运行的关键。
总而言之,VS Code离线插件的存放和管理虽然需要一些手动操作,但对于无法访问互联网的开发环境,这提供了极大的便利和灵活性。通过熟悉VS Code插件的安装与管理流程,用户可以最大限度地利用这款强大的代码编辑器。
相关问答FAQs:
问题一:VSCode离线插件应该放在哪个目录下?
对于VSCode离线插件,你可以将它们放在VSCode的扩展目录中。扩展目录的位置取决于你所使用的操作系统。下面我将为你详细介绍各个平台的扩展目录位置。
-
Windows操作系统:在Windows上,默认的扩展目录位于
%USERPROFILE%\.vscode\extensions
路径中。你可以通过将插件文件夹直接拷贝到该目录下实现离线安装。 -
macOS操作系统:在macOS上,VSCode的默认扩展目录位于
~/.vscode/extensions
路径下。你可通过将插件文件夹直接拷贝到该目录下进行离线安装。 -
Linux操作系统:尽管Linux上的扩展目录与macOS上的扩展目录类似,位于
~/.vscode/extensions
路径下,但VSCode还支持用户可以自定义扩展目录的位置。你可以通过VSCode的设置来指定自定义的扩展目录,然后将插件文件夹拷贝到该目录中。
在将插件放入扩展目录后,重新启动VSCode,插件将会生效。
问题二:如何在VSCode离线安装插件?
离线安装VSCode插件的步骤与在线安装相似,只需将插件文件夹拷贝到扩展目录即可。
- 首先,你需要从VSCode的插件商店或其他来源下载插件的压缩包或文件夹。
- 接下来,打开VSCode并选择左侧的扩展图标(或按下
Ctrl+Shift+X
)打开扩展视图。 - 在扩展视图的右上角,你会看到一个“…”按钮,点击它,然后选择从VSIX安装。
- 在弹出的文件选择器中,浏览到你下载的插件压缩包或文件夹,选择它并点击打开。
- 安装过程完成后,插件将会在扩展视图中列出并启用。
问题三:有哪些适合离线安装的VSCode插件?
许多VSCode插件都支持离线安装,这在一些特定场景下非常有用。以下是几类适合离线安装的VSCode插件:
-
常用工具类插件:包括代码格式化、导航工具、Git工具等。这些插件可以帮助提高开发效率,而离线安装无需依赖网络环境,确保在任何时候也可以使用。
-
语言支持插件:针对特定编程语言的支持插件,例如JavaScript、Python、Java等。这些插件可以提供语法高亮、代码补全等功能,离线安装使得你可以在没有网络连接的环境下继续编写代码。
-
主题和配色方案插件:用于改变VSCode编辑器的外观和美化的插件。这些插件能够提供各种各样的主题和配色方案,让你的编辑器界面更加个性化,离线安装保证了你可以随时切换外观而不受网络限制。
通过离线安装插件,你可以确保在没有网络的情况下也能充分利用VSCode的强大功能。记住,及时更新插件以保持安全和性能也是十分重要的。
文章标题:vscode离线插件放在哪里,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/1963588